Overview

A group of armed robbers fleeing the police head for the New Jersey Tunnel and run right into trucks transporting toxic waste. The spectacular explosion that follows results in both ends of the tunnel collapsing and the handful of people who survived the explosion are now in peril. Kit Latura is the only man with the skill and knowledge to lead the band of survivors out of the tunnel before the structure collapses.

Summary

"Daylight - No air. No escape. No time." is english Language Movie.

"Daylight" was released on 06 December 1996 it had a budget of $80,000,000 and had box office collection of $159,212,469.

The movie was directed by Rob Cohen
